Identifying Unlicensed Brokers:
To avoid falling prey to investment scams like Lonryd SmileFlex, it’s essential to know how to identify unlicensed brokers. Key indicators include:
- Lack of licensing information or regulatory compliance.
- Unrealistic promises of high returns with minimal risk.
- Poor website quality, lack of transparency, or vague information about the company.
- Bad reviews, scam reports, or warnings from regulatory bodies.
Being vigilant and conducting thorough research before investing can significantly reduce the risk of encountering unlicensed brokers.
Steps to Take After Falling for a Scam:
If you have already invested in Lonryd SmileFlex or a similar unlicensed broker, here are crucial steps to follow:
- Stop all communication: Immediately cease any interaction with the scam broker to prevent further loss.
- Report the scam: Inform relevant authorities, such as your local financial regulatory body or the police, about the scam. Reporting helps in creating a record and can assist in potential recovery efforts.
- Contact your bank or payment provider: Inform them about the scam and seek their assistance in recovering your funds or securing your accounts.
- Consider identity theft protection: Scam brokers often compromise personal and financial information. Monitoring your accounts and considering identity theft protection services can help mitigate potential damage.
- Warn others: Share your experience through reviews and scam reporting websites. This can help prevent others from falling victim to the same scam.
